For those of you like me but afraid to ask...Some general characteristics of VIP Style are:
  • Large/wide wheels (many times with big lips and low offsets) that are flush to the fender
  • Stretched tires in order to tuck the wheels under the fenders
  • Low stance via adjustable suspension or air ride
  • Substantial body kits to achieve the “Wide” look
  • Custom body work to accentuate the “Wide” look
  • Custom video and audio components and installations
  • Wood grain interiors with additional trays and extensions on the dash
  • Custom seats and mats
  • Additional and upgraded internal and external lighting
  • Louder exhausts with larger tips
  • Engine/performance work (though not as popular)
